CVE-2026-0287
PAN-OS Análisis y mitigación de vulnerabilidades

Vista general

CVE-2026-0287 describes multiple denial of service (DoS) vulnerabilities in Palo Alto Networks PAN-OS® software, Cloud NGFW, and Prisma Access. An unauthenticated attacker with network access can send specially crafted traffic to or through a dataplane interface to trigger a DoS condition; repeated exploitation causes the firewall to enter maintenance mode. Panorama is explicitly not affected. The vulnerability was discovered internally by Palo Alto Networks and publicly disclosed on July 8, 2026. It carries a CVSS v3.1 base score of 7.5 (High) and a CVSS v4.0 base score of 6.6 (Medium) (PAN Advisory, GitHub Advisory).

Técnicas

The root cause is classified as CWE-754 (Improper Check for Unusual or Exceptional Conditions), meaning the PAN-OS dataplane fails to properly handle malformed or unexpected network traffic. An unauthenticated attacker with network-level access can send specially crafted packets to or through a dataplane interface, causing the affected process to crash or enter an unrecoverable state. No special configuration is required for exposure — any reachable dataplane interface is a valid attack surface. Repeated triggering of the condition escalates the impact by forcing the firewall into maintenance mode, requiring manual recovery. No public proof-of-concept code or technical write-up detailing the specific packet structure has been published (PAN Advisory).

Impacto

Successful exploitation results in a complete loss of availability for the affected firewall or network gateway, with no impact to confidentiality or integrity. A single exploitation attempt causes a DoS condition on the dataplane; repeated attempts force the device into maintenance mode, requiring administrator intervention to restore normal operation. Because PAN-OS firewalls and Cloud NGFW instances are typically deployed as critical network chokepoints, disruption can affect all traffic flowing through the device, potentially impacting downstream network segments and services. Prisma Access deployments have built-in resilience that partially mitigates the impact (PAN Advisory).

Explotabilidad

Palo Alto Networks has confirmed no known malicious exploitation of this vulnerability at the time of disclosure, and no public proof-of-concept exists (PAN Advisory). The CVSS v4.0 exploit maturity is rated "UNREPORTED." The EPSS score is approximately 0.587% (44th percentile), indicating a relatively low near-term exploitation probability (GitHub Advisory). The vulnerability is not listed in the CISA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) catalog. No threat actor attribution has been reported.

Indicadores de compromiso

  • Network: Unusual or malformed traffic directed at or through PAN-OS dataplane interfaces; unexpected spikes in dataplane traffic from external sources.
  • Logs: PAN-OS system logs showing repeated dataplane process crashes or restarts; log entries indicating the firewall has entered or attempted to enter maintenance mode.
  • System State: Firewall unexpectedly in maintenance mode requiring manual recovery; loss of traffic forwarding through the device without a known administrative cause.
  • Management Alerts: Automated alerts from Panorama or monitoring systems indicating firewall unavailability or health degradation on managed devices.

Mitigación y soluciones alternativas

Palo Alto Networks has released patched versions and states no workarounds exist for this issue. Administrators should upgrade to the following fixed versions based on their deployment branch (PAN Advisory):

  • PAN-OS 10.2: 10.2.7-h36, 10.2.10-h39, 10.2.13-h23, 10.2.16-h9, 10.2.18-h8 or later
  • PAN-OS 11.1: 11.1.4-h35, 11.1.6-h35, 11.1.7-h8, 11.1.10-h30, 11.1.13-h9, 11.1.16 or later
  • PAN-OS 11.2: 11.2.4-h20, 11.2.7-h18, 11.2.10-h12, 11.2.13 or later
  • PAN-OS 12.1: 12.1.4-h8, 12.1.7-h2, 12.1.8 or later
  • Prisma Access 10.2: 10.2.10-h39 or later; Prisma Access 11.2: 11.2.7-h18 or later
  • Cloud NGFW: Palo Alto Networks will upgrade all customers during the next scheduled maintenance cycle; customers requiring earlier upgrades should contact support.

As an interim measure, restricting untrusted network access to dataplane interfaces where operationally feasible can reduce exposure.

Reacciones de la comunidad

The vulnerability received routine coverage from security monitoring organizations including HKCERT, which published a security bulletin for Palo Alto products on July 9, 2026, and CERT GARR, which issued an alert on July 10, 2026. Social media activity was limited to automated CVE tracking accounts on Mastodon and Bluesky. No notable independent researcher commentary or significant media coverage has been identified beyond standard vulnerability aggregation and advisory republication.
